Phantom Assemblies

Phantom Assemblies A phantom assembly is typically a non-stocked assembly that groups the components needed to produce a subassembly. For example, compare a phantom assembly to folders on a computer. Item Fulfillment has No GL Impact

Scenario The user noted some Item fulfillment that does not post any value in the GL impact.
